Here’s how to write a perfect cover letter for investment banking jobs:

  1. Follow the right cover letter format.
  2. Address the bank hiring manager directly.
  3. Start with a compelling intro statement.
  4. Explain why you are the best candidate.
  5. Give some key achievements to stand out.
  6. Show them why you want to work at this bank.

How do I write a cover letter for a financial analyst position?

Cover Letter Tips State why you’re excited about the job and the company, and how the job matches your career goals. In one or two paragraphs, connect your past accomplishments with the requirements listed in the job description. Focus on your most relevant experience, qualifications and skills.

Do you need a cover letter for investment banking?

Spending your time networking will dramatically increase the chances of you get a job in investment banking (or any other analyst job on Wall Street). Unless you’re from an Ivy or have a great connection already, put 90% of your time into networking, not worry about a cover letter for investment banking.

What should be included in a cover letter?

When writing a cover letter, be sure to reference the requirements listed in the job description. In your letter, reference your most relevant or exceptional qualifications to help employers see why you’re a great fit for the role.

Who are the clients of an investment analyst?

Investment Analysts deliver data enabling brokers, traders, and fund managers to make decisions related to investments. These experts are usually hired by wealthy individuals, banks, corporations, nonprofit organizations, and life assurance companies.
